We developed a 17.3’’ FHD 360HZ high‐end electronic competitive LCD in IGZO. For reducing the risk of pixel capacitance undercharge, we designed zigzag pixel structure and used pre‐charge driving mode. In addition, this product uses fast response liquid crystal and dynamic OD technology to reduce response time. Moreover, the downward backlit Local Dimming partition control is designed to meet HDR specifications.
